7 Marketing Concepts

Marketing is defined by the American Marketing Association as: "the activity, set of institutions, and processes for creating, communicating, delivering, and exchanging offerings that have value for customers, clients, partners, and society at large.“

1- BRAND 

Branding is, in my personal opinion, the most important first step to a successful business. It’s the heartbeat behind a company- the who you are & what you are about shown through little details. Consumers don’t recognize how impactful a good brand strategy is for businesses, but as a business owner, it is the most important. Sure, for some it may just seem like picking a good font or a pretty color, but the intention behind logo & graphics, values & mission statement create the pulse that starts & continues through your success. Using my brand for an example of this : My verbiage across all platforms flows with a similar message to my mission statement. Language used in videos tells the stories of NGOs positive work while showing what life is really like. Both imagery & video feel raw/gritty/authentic which goes along with the texture in my logo… bet you didn’t think of that when you first saw it but you’re shaking your head in agreement now that you know. That’s exactly what good branding does.

3- ONE SHEET

If you haven’t created a One Sheet for your business yet, DO IT! A one sheet is like combination of those trifold brochures that are no longer a thing, and a resume. Basically, a snapshot of your skills. 5- TESTIMONIALS 

No one can sell you better than people you have worked with in the past. They know you, they know what you can do. Take the time to create interview settings & let people say nice things about you. The pay out of someone’s word is literally invaluable. Customers listen to other customers! 6- REFERRALS 

Speaking of customers, ask previous customers for referrals. Leave business cards with them, give them a couple of one sheets & ask them to help spread the word. Also, make sure if they DO get you a referral, you send a thank you note or gift. They’ve just become investors in your company & that is a big deal. 7- COMMUNITY GIVEBACK

Think of ways you can plug in to & be an investor not only in your own company, but in the companies of the community you live or work in. Go to local business events, networking meetings, or create your own. Get a group of like minded business owners or friends together & start conversations that matter. You would be surprised to see how many customers appreciate the efforts to give outside of the business. That sounds like a win-win to me!
